Presidents’ Day stops much public business
Date: February 18, 2013
Today is a federal holiday, and many offices and banks are closed.
The offices of the town of Jackson are closed, as are the offices of Teton County government, including the Teton County Courthouse.
Public schools are closed, as are United States Postal Service post offices.
Grand Teton and Yellowstone national parks are open. The administrative offices of the two national parks are closed. The Craig Thomas Discovery and Visitor Center in Moose is open.
The offices of the Bridger-Teton National Forest are closed.
Offices of the National Elk Refuge are closed, but the Jackson Hole and Greater Yellowstone Visitor Center on North Cache is open and will offer a family program (see Community Calendar). Sleigh rides on the National Elk Refuge will continue over the holiday.
